This is a limited power of attorney for New Mexico. You specify the powers you desire to give to your agent. Sample powers are attached to the form for illustration only and should be deleted after you complete the form with the powers you desire. The form contains an acknowledgment in the event the form is to be recorded. Las Cruces, New Mexico Limited Power of Attorney is a legal document that grants an individual, known as the "principal," the ability to delegate specific powers to another person, known as the "attorney-in-fact," for a predetermined period or specific task. This arrangement allows the attorney-in-fact to act on behalf of the principal in certain matters, while restricting the scope of authority. There are different types of Limited Power of Attorney in Las Cruces, New Mexico, depending on the specific powers being granted. Here are a few examples: 1. Limited Power of Attorney for Property Management: This type of limited power of attorney grants the attorney-in-fact the authority to manage the principal's real estate, rental properties, or other tangible assets. The specified powers may include collecting rent, paying bills, signing leases, and handling property maintenance. 2. Limited Power of Attorney for Financial Matters: With this type of limited power of attorney, the attorney-in-fact is given the authority to handle the principal's financial affairs. This may involve tasks such as managing bank accounts, making investment decisions, paying bills, and filing taxes. 3. Limited Power of Attorney for Healthcare: In this case, the limited power of attorney allows the attorney-in-fact to make healthcare decisions on behalf of the principal. This might entail consenting to medical treatments, accessing medical records, discussing care options with doctors, and making end-of-life decisions. 4. Limited Power of Attorney for Business Transactions: This type of limited power of attorney is often utilized in business settings. It grants the attorney-in-fact the power to enter into contracts, negotiate deals, sign legal documents, and make financial decisions related to the principal's business matters. Sample Powers Included: 1. To buy, sell, lease, or mortgage specific real estate properties located within Las Cruces, New Mexico 2. To operate and manage bank accounts, including making deposits, withdrawals, and transfers, for the principal's financial affairs 3. To file taxes, represent the principal before the IRS, and handle all tax-related matters 4. To consent to or decline medical treatment, surgical procedures, and hospitalization on behalf of the principal 5. To manage investments, stocks, bonds, and other financial instruments held by the principal 6. To negotiate and execute contracts, agreements, and legal documents related to the principal's business activities. It is important to note that the powers included in a Las Cruces, New Mexico Limited Power of Attorney can vary based on the specific requirements and preferences of the principal. Seeking legal advice and assistance is highly recommended ensuring that the document accurately reflects the principal's intentions and adheres to the applicable laws in Las Cruces, New Mexico.
